The Squam Lakes Natural Science Center, located in Holderness, NH, advances understanding of ecology by exploring the natural world. This podcast is one way that we explore the natural world. Check out our website to learn more: www. NHNature.org Episodes discuss how animals survive and what makes them unique. Listen in to explore the wild around you!
